What Matters Most
General liability insurance ($500-2,000/year) is the baseline every business needs. Professional liability (E&O), commercial property, and workers' comp are additional layers that depend on your industry.
Pro Tip
A Business Owner's Policy (BOP) bundles general liability with commercial property insurance at 15-30% less than buying them separately.
Common Mistake
Assuming a home-based business is covered by homeowner's insurance. Most home policies exclude business equipment and business liability — a $200/year endorsement closes this gap.

Business Insurance Cost: Scranton vs State & National Average
| Category | Scranton | Pennsylvania Avg |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Average cost | $1,854 | $1,858 | $1,750 |
| Low estimate | $530 | $1,394 | $1,313 |
| High estimate | $3,178 | $2,415 | $2,275 |
